Understanding the Pricing Structure of Container Transport Brisbane

The container transport Brisbane cost, just like in other places, depends on various factors. Keep in mind that specific prices may differ based on your specific needs and the transport provider you select. Here are some key elements of the pricing structure:

1. Distance and Route

The distance from pickup to delivery greatly affects the cost of container transport in Brisbane. As a fundamental driver of costs, it’s worth noting that longer distances typically translate into higher transport fees. Moreover, the specific route chosen can significantly impact not only the overall distance but also travel time and fuel expenses. The selection of the most efficient route becomes crucial in optimizing costs while ensuring timely and cost-effective container transport.

2. Shipping Container Sizes and Type

Container size and type are critical factors in assessing the cost of your container transport needs in Brisbane. It’s important to recognize that the choice of container directly influences pricing. Standard containers, such as the widely used 20-foot and 40-foot varieties, come with their own distinct pricing structures.

Additionally, specialized containers designed for specific good types, like refrigerated or hazardous materials containers, may incur additional charges. Choosing the right container size and type is crucial for cost management and ensuring your good’s safety.

3. Weight and Volume

The weight and volume of your shipping container are key determinants of the overall transportation costs. Heavier and bulkier shipping container necessitates more resources for transport, which inevitably results in higher fees. Knowing how weight and volume affect costs is essential for budgeting and making container transport in Brisbane more cost-effective.

4. Mode of Transport

Your choice of transport mode significantly influences the cost structure of container transport. Brisbane offers various fleet or transportation options, including road, rail, sea, and combinations thereof. Each mode comes with its own unique pricing structure and associated charges.

Road transport may involve fees such as tolls and permits, while sea transport includes port-related costs. Weighing the advantages and costs of each mode is essential for aligning your transport needs with your budget and logistical requirements.

5. Packing and unpacking

The process of packing and unpacking involves labour costs. If you require assistance with these tasks, it’s essential to consider these potential additional expenses in your overall budget. Organized packing and unpacking can make container transport in Brisbane more cost-effective by streamlining operations and reducing labour expenses.

6. Special Requirements

Certain types of goods may come with special requirements, such as temperature control or enhanced security measures. These specialized needs can result in added costs during container transport. For example, refrigerated containers, necessary for perishable goods, might cost more because they require constant temperature monitoring and maintenance. Knowing your container’s specific needs and costs is essential for smooth and cost-effective transport in Brisbane.

7. Customs and Documentation

Beyond the basic transport charges, it’s important to consider fees related to customs clearance and documentation. Having all the required paperwork is important for following rules and avoiding problems that could increase the cost of shipping containers. Properly managing customs and documentation requirements is an integral part of cost-effective container transport operations in Brisbane.

8. Insurance

While not always included in the base price, insurance is a consideration that can provide peace of mind and financial protection. This additional safeguard is particularly valuable in the uncertain world of international container transport. Shipping insurance can shield your goods against unforeseen events during transport, helping mitigate potential financial losses. Knowing the price and advantages of insurance is important when considering the total expenses of shipping containers in Brisbane.

9. Other Additional Costs and Fees

Besides the mentioned factors, extra fees can impact container transport costs in Brisbane. Terminal Handling Charges (THC) include handling at terminals. Fuel Surcharges adjust for fuel price fluctuations. Demurrage and detention fees encourage timely returns.

Port and terminal fees cover facility use. Customs duties and taxes may apply based on container specifics and trade rules, potentially increasing the total expense.
